Based on backstepping design,adaptive control and sliding mode control,a new adaptive backstepping sliding mode controller was designed for the case of a three-dimensional interception.To confirm the upper bound of uncertainties in sliding-mode control system,considering the maneuvering acceleration of targets as a disturbance.An adaptive law was designed to estimate the value of upper bound in real-time,and its stability and error convergence were testified based on the Lyapunov theorem.Simulation results show that the adaptive backstepping sliding mode law is effective.
